Real Estate Market
The View Basin real estate market is active, with a median home value of $410,000 and homes typically selling after about 15 days on the market. The median price per square foot is approximately $603, and the median monthly rent is $1,722. An impressive 89% homeownership rate underscores the neighborhood's stability and appeal to buyers.

Transportation & Connectivity
The neighborhood is primarily accessed by car, with State Route 16 providing a key artery for commuting to Tacoma and beyond. While public transit options exist in the broader Gig Harbor area, most residents rely on personal vehicles for daily transportation. View Basin Market Data
| Metric | Value | Source |
|---|---|---|
| Median Home Price | $410K | U.S. Census ACS 2022 |
| Median Gross Rent | $2K/mo | U.S. Census ACS 2022 |
| Median Household Income | $104K | U.S. Census ACS 2022 |
| Homeownership Rate | 88.7% | U.S. Census ACS 2022 |
| Renter-Occupied | 11.3% | U.S. Census ACS 2022 |
| Rental Vacancy Rate | 6.5% | U.S. Census ACS 2022 |
| Market Type | Balanced | U.S. Census ACS 2022 |
| Market Tier | Upper-Mid | Top10Lists.us Classification |
| Primary ZIP Code | 98329 |
